This is a cosmetic item, same with the other potion that gives you floating horns.

Nobody is being “punished” for being “late-adopters” of the game. This does not grant any boons, any combat advantages, or effects any part of the game besides giving an aesthetic halo/horns to the player character that gets disabled every time you zone, get downed, or die.

They were not achievement items so they were not put into the laurel merchant. The baby dolyak potion and panda mini were not achievement items either, but they were added as festival rewards for those who already had them all as an incentive to run the little races and kill the bosses at the Pavilion. The Halloween items were put there because at that time ArenaNet decided to mix the Living World with Holidays.

Key word: Incentive. Why go through all the trouble of attending a limited time event (Siege of Lion’s Arch), go through all the trouble of finding heirlooms during that limited time, and spend the 10g per potion when months later they get added as gemstore items?

That is a huge slap to the face to those who worked for them. No, simply no. Would be fine if ArenaNet added them permanently in some event or minigame which required the player to collect time-gated tokens just like we did. But it still doesn’t address the fact that this was meant to be a limited time item exclusive to those who attended, yes, exclusive. Big scary word, oooo.

When the event was released, we were all under the assumption that the chance to acquire these potions was going to be gone after 2 weeks. At that time, for the first few days, we also didn’t know all of the locations of the heirlooms so in the duration of those 2 weeks we thought you could only get one based on your character’s reason for collecting them, selfless or thoughtless, for personal gain or to give back to those who lost everything. All that rushing, all that effort, would be for nothing if they were simply added to the gemstore.

There’s nothing wrong with wanting to earn rewards late, like the wings of the sunless, but the logic of “I work hard for my IRL money so that should translate to farming in game” is flawed.

These are not comparable activities because 800 gems may cost me a lot less in “real dollars” than they cost you simply because we live in different places, make different amounts of money, have different levels of living/family expenses, or whatever reason. Some people make 800 gems every five minutes in interest from having money in the bank.

In game our earning power is normalized by the strictures of the rules of play. This is why they made the old LS rewards laurel-based, to ensure those that wanted to be late adopters had to earn them rather than cash in gems>gold and pick them up with little to no effort. It ensures that all players that want to pick them up have equal earning power so as not to trivialize the acquisition of what are “antique and limited edition” rewards.

There are already a dizzying array of skins and items designed around gem purchases, which are far easier to obtain by spending your real money, and that’s okay, because that’s their permanent acquisition model. LS rewards are simply on a different account-bound acquisition model to ensure that nobody can simply buy them with some gold or gems, and that doesn’t need to be disrupted.
